Seamless IDE and Build Integrations

Works with VS Code and Eclipse, enabling developers to leverage IAR’s advanced toolchain within familiar environments. Supports CMake-based builds, allowing flexible project configuration, cross-platform development, and smooth integration with CI/CD pipelines for automated testing and deployment.

Multi-Project Support

Manage multiple configurations and projects within the same workspace, allowing developers to work on different versions, debug multiple targets, and easily switch between project setups for flexible and efficient embedded development.

Advanced Debugging Capabilities

The IAR C-SPY Debugger provides real-time trace, code coverage, function profiling, and RTOS awareness, helping developers gain deep insights into software execution and optimize performance efficiently.

Extensive Hardware Support

Works with a wide range of debug probes, emulators, and evaluation boards, ensuring developers can test, debug, and validate embedded systems under real-world conditions. Supports I-jet, I-jet Trace, J-Link, PE Micro and ST-LINK probes, providing reliable and efficient debugging.

Integrated Static and Runtime Analysis

Use IAR C-STAT for static code analysis to enforce coding standards and IAR C-RUN* for runtime error detection, helping identify vulnerabilities, improve reliability, and ensure high-quality embedded applications.

*Available for Arm and RX.

RTOS Support

Gain instant RTOS awareness with built-in plugins for leading real-time operating systems, like PX5 RTOS and Zephyr RTOS, enabling task-level debugging, event tracing, and seamless integration with RTOS-specific features for enhanced embedded software development.

FAQ

What architectures and microcontrollers are supported?

IAR Embedded Workbench supports a wide range of microcontrollers, including Arm, RISC-V, 8051, MSP430, AVR, AVR32, Renesas RX, Renesas RL78, Renesas RH850, Renesas V850, M16C/R8C, Renesas 78K, and STM8. Legacy architectures such as ColdFire, CR16C, H8, HCS12, M32C, MAXQ, R32C, S08, SAM8, and SH are available by request only.

How does it improve development efficiency?

By integrating compilation, debugging, and analysis in a single environment, developers can reduce context switching and streamline their workflow.

Can it be used in functional safety applications?

Yes, IAR Embedded Workbench includes certified tools for functional safety development, with TÜV SÜD-certified versions available for compliance with industry safety standards.

Can IAR Embedded Workbench be integrated with other development environments?

Yes, IAR Embedded Workbench integrates with VS Code via the IAR Build and Debug extensions, allowing developers to code and debug using a modern interface. It also supports Eclipse IDE through plug-ins for workflow compatibility. Additionally, it can be integrated with third-party build and CI/CD systems such as Jenkins, GitHub Actions, and GitLab CI/CD using IAR Build Tools. This ensures flexibility for teams that work in hybrid development environments.

Can IAR Embedded Workbench support third-party extensions?

Yes, the toolchain supports third-party RTOS debugging extensions such as FreeRTOS, Azure RTOS, Zephyr RTOS and PX5 RTOS. It also allows the use of middleware libraries, including TCP/IP stacks, file systems, and security frameworks. Additionally, it is compatible with hardware debugging tools from vendors like Segger, PE Micro, and Renesas, TI, and more, enabling cross-platform debugging.
